Dixie Chicks, PCD & Furtado At AMAs

The Dixie Chicks, Pussycat Dolls, and Nelly Furtado have all joined the lineup of performers at the 2006 American Music Awards.

Furtado is nominated for Favorite Female Artist Pop/Rock and Pussycat Dolls are nominated for Favorite Band, Duo or Group Pop/Rock. The Dixie Chicks are not nominated for an award.

The show, hosted by Jimmy Kimmel, will air live on ABC on Tuesday, Nov. 21, 2006.

Previously announced performers include Beyonce, Mary J. Blige, Carrie Underwood and Josh Groban.

Mariah Carey, the Red Hot Chili Peppers, the Black Eyed Peas and Nickelback each captured three American Music Award nominations.

Mary J. Blige, Eminem, Kanye West, Jamie Foxx, T.I., Rascal Flatts, Pussycat Dolls, Kelly Clarkson and Carrie Underwood earned a pair of nods each.

The nominees in 20 categories were chosen based on record sales. Winners of the American Music Awards are selected by the public, based on a national sampling of approximately 20,000 people.
